现代化牛舍设计与环境控制技术

Site selection and layout are the first steps in planning and design. Cattle farms should be located in areas with high and dry terrain, sheltered from wind and facing the sun, with sufficient water sources and good drainage, at least 500 meters from main traffic arteries and residential areas, while also considering the convenience of feed transportation and product sales. The orientation of cattle barns should be adapted to local conditions, with northern regions primarily adopting a south-facing orientation to fully utilize winter sunlight for heating, while southern regions may adopt a slightly southeast-facing orientation conducive to summer ventilation and cooling. Functional zones should be rationally arranged according to prevailing wind direction and terrain elevation, with the living management area upwind, the production area in the middle, and the manure treatment area downwind, constructing a scientific biosafety zoning system.

Cattle barn structural design needs to balance structural strength, thermal insulation, and economic practicality. Common cattle barn structural forms include open, semi-open, and enclosed types. Open barns have low construction costs and good ventilation effects, suitable for warm southern regions. Semi-open barns balance ventilation and insulation with broader applicability. Enclosed barns have good insulation performance and are suitable for severely cold northern regions but require supporting mechanical ventilation systems. Barn span is determined based on rearing scale and method, with single-row barn spans generally 8-10 meters and double-row barn spans 15-20 meters, with eaves height not less than 3.5 meters, ensuring sufficient space volume and good lighting conditions.

The ventilation system is the most critical aspect of cattle barn environmental control. Good ventilation can effectively remove excess heat, moisture, harmful gases, and dust from barns, providing cattle with fresh air environments. Cattle barn ventilation methods are divided into natural ventilation and mechanical ventilation. Natural ventilation relies on thermal pressure and wind pressure driving, with ventilation opening areas reaching 15-20% of barn floor area, ridge opening width not less than 30 centimeters, and adjustable wind deflectors to adapt to different climatic conditions. Mechanical ventilation is suitable for enclosed or semi-enclosed barns, using negative pressure ventilation systems with fans generally installed on side or gable walls, automatically adjusting operating numbers and speeds based on indoor temperature. Minimum ventilation rates in winter should ensure at least four air exchanges per hour.

Summer heat stress is an important environmental factor affecting cattle production performance. When ambient temperature exceeds 25 degrees Celsius, cattle feed intake begins to decrease, and when it exceeds 32 degrees Celsius, milk production significantly declines. Barn cooling measures include shading, misting, and forced ventilation in various ways. Shade nets or awnings can effectively reduce solar radiation heat, and tall trees should be planted in outdoor exercise areas to provide natural shade. Misting cooling systems intermittently spray water to wet cattle bodies, combined with forced ventilation for evaporative heat dissipation, which can reduce cattle perceived temperature by 5-8 degrees Celsius. It should be noted that adequate ventilation must be ensured after misting to avoid more severe heat stress caused by high temperature and high humidity.

The manure treatment system is an indispensable component of modern cattle farm design. Dry manure cleaning processes should be adopted, using scrapers or mechanical manure cleaning equipment to promptly remove manure from barns, reducing the production of harmful gases such as ammonia and hydrogen sulfide indoors. Stalls should be designed with a front-high, rear-low slope of 1-2% gradient to facilitate urine and flushing water drainage into manure channels. After manure collection, it enters a solid-liquid separation system, with the solid portion composted and fermented for land application, and the liquid portion anaerobically fermented to produce biogas before being used as organic fertilizer for farmland irrigation.
